Wasabi hot cloud storage is a new class and category of cloud storage, breaking all traditional barriers and boundaries of storage with a disruptive value proposition of being 1/5th the cost of AWS S3, faster than the competition, with no fees for egress or API requests. Cloud storage has never been so simple, so fast and so inexpensive. It’s all part of our vision to make cloud storage the next great global utility, just like electricity.

Role Description: Sr. Salesforce Developer
 
Role Purpose: 
 

The Senior Salesforce Developer plays a key role in designing, building, and optimizing Salesforce solutions that support scalable revenue operations. This role focuses heavily on Salesforce CPQ and Billing, while also contributing to platform innovation, operational stability, and early adoption of AI-driven capabilities within the Salesforce ecosystem. 

This is a hands-on engineering role with strong collaboration across product, business, and architecture teams.

Responsibilities:
    • Design, build, and maintain scalable Salesforce solutions with a strong focus on CPQ, Billing, and end-to-end Quote-to-Cash workflows. 
    • Develop high-quality, maintainable solutions using Apex, Flow, Lightning Web Components (LWC), and declarative tools, aligned with development standards. 
    • Configure and enhance pricing, quoting, subscriptions, renewals, amendments, and billing, including complex and usage-based pricing models. 
    • Partner with admins, product, and finance teams to ensure accurate, scalable quoting, billing, and contract lifecycle behavior. 
    • Stay current on Salesforce platform and AI capabilities (e.g., Einstein, Agentforce) and contribute to thoughtful automation and incremental innovation. 
    • Collaborate with product managers, architects, QA, and developers during sprint execution, technical design, and code reviews. 
    • Ensure solution quality through unit testing, automated test coverage, and production support, including root cause analysis. 
    • Identify technical debt and performance issues and drive continuous improvement. 
    • Share knowledge through documentation and peer collaboration, providing informal guidance to junior developers and admins. 
    • Contribute to a culture of ownership, accountability, and continuous improvement. 
Requirements:
    •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or a related field (or equivalent experience).
    • 5years of hands-on Salesforce development experience, including Salesforce CPQ and Billing.
    • Strong experience with Apex, Flow, LWC, and Salesforce declarative automation.
    • Solid understanding of Quote-to-Cash processes and subscription-based revenue models.
    • Interest in AI-driven automation and emerging Salesforce platform capabilities.
    • Salesforce certifications preferred (Platform Developer I &II, CPQ Specialist).
    • Strong problem-solving skills and attention to detail.
    • Ability to execute independently while collaborating effectively within a team.
